Transaction 23e15f126f386e856024718fdee246abbf3459c2766262824567c200b31ed7d4

1 Input
2 Outputs
  • 23e15f126f386e856024718fdee246abbf3459c2766262824567c200b31ed7d4:0
  • value  1220124
    address  34TD1B1MNJsziy1XNnAucsWs9B9kv7xwD2
  • 23e15f126f386e856024718fdee246abbf3459c2766262824567c200b31ed7d4:1
  • value  7095228
    address  bc1qrlmkp5zcslt8872pqcswk7fmwcx6zfufdcxd9f